Grilled Chicken Caesar Salad with Creamy Lemon-Garlic Dressing
Enjoy a refreshing twist on the classic Caesar salad with perfectly grilled chicken, crisp romaine lettuce, a sprinkle of Parmesan, and crunchy whole wheat croutons, all tossed in a homemade creamy lemon-garlic dressing. This dish marries bright, zesty flavors with the savory depth of grilled chicken for a satisfying meal.
INGREDIENTS
5 ounces Chicken Breast (cooked, grilled)
2 cups shredded Romaine Lettuce
2 tablespoons Parmesan Cheese
1/4 cup Whole Wheat Croutons
2 tablespoons Greek Yogurt
1 teaspoon Fresh Lemon Juice
1/2 teaspoon Extra-Virgin Olive Oil
1 Garlic Clove
Salt and Black Pepper to taste
PREPARATION
Preheat a grill or grill pan over medium-high heat and lightly oil the surface.
Season the chicken breast with salt and pepper. Grill for 6-7 minutes per side or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F. Let rest and then slice thinly.
In a small bowl, combine the Greek yogurt, lemon juice, extra-virgin olive oil, minced garlic, a pinch of salt, and pepper to create the creamy lemon-garlic dressing.
In a large salad bowl, toss together the shredded romaine lettuce, Parmesan cheese, and whole wheat croutons.
Top the salad with the sliced grilled chicken and drizzle with the lemon-garlic dressing.
Serve immediately and enjoy a balanced, flavorful meal.
